FanDuel Unveils Mobile Sports Betting in Kentucky, Enhancing Options for Sports Enthusiasts


In a groundbreaking move on September 28, 2023, FanDuel Group launched its mobile sports betting services in Kentucky. This development allows sports enthusiasts in Kentucky seamless access to the FanDuel Sportsbook app, available on both iOS and Android devices, as well as through desktop platforms.


FanDuel, widely acknowledged as a premier online sportsbook in the United States, offers an extensive spectrum of betting opportunities encompassing professional sports, college sports, and international sporting events. Additionally, the platform presents a plethora of enticing promotions and bonuses, catering to both newcomers and loyal patrons.


This momentous launch represents a significant stride for sports aficionados in Kentucky, providing them with expanded choices for wagering on their beloved teams and events.

TeachMe.To Secure $2 Million in Seed Funding for Sports Coaching Platform


In a recent development, TeachMe.To, a platform designed to assist budding athletes in connecting with local coaches, has secured $2 million in seed funding during September 2023. Nick O'Brien, CEO of TeachMe.To, underscored the company's vision, stating, "Learning something new can be intimidating — that's why most of us don't start. TeachMe.To takes the guesswork out of finding a coach, so you can focus on improving your skills and having fun.


This app will streamline the process of scheduling and managing lessons, further enhancing the user experience. With its innovative approach, TeachMe.To is poised to make a lasting impact on the sports coaching industry.

Kinduct and N3XT Sports Forge Strategic Partnership to Elevate Athlete Data Management in Sports


In a significant development, Kinduct and N3XT Sports have announced a strategic partnership in September 2023. This collaboration designates Kinduct's Athlete Management System (AMS) as the preferred platform for all of N3XT Sports' endeavors within the sports industry, enhancing their comprehensive data strategy offerings.


The synergy between Kinduct and N3XT Sports promises to provide sports organizations with an all-encompassing solution for effective athlete data management. Matt Warburton, Senior Client Success Manager, Sports Science at Kinduct, emphasized the success of this collaboration in integrating data-driven decision-making into the daily workflows of sports organizations, ultimately fostering high-performance sports success.

Apex Launches €50 Million Elite Performance Fund with Backing from Sports Icons


Lisbon-based venture capital firm Apex has unveiled its ambitious €50 million Elite Performance Fund, garnering support from renowned sports luminaries such as Formula One stars Lando Norris and Carlos Sainz, soccer sensations Raphaël Varane and Christian Eriksen, and accomplished surfer Kanoa Igarashi.

The fund's primary focus lies in strategic investments within the sports, media, and entertainment sectors. Apex is actively seeking innovative companies that are pioneering cutting-edge technologies and products geared toward enhancing the performance and overall experience of athletes, coaches, and sports enthusiasts.
